🛍️ As a retail merchandiser, your primary goal is to maximize sales and increase volume for both the retailer and the manufacturer.

🤝 You will have the opportunity to build relationships with store management to ensure proper stock levels, appropriate merchandise display, and favorable shelf placement.

📋 Before entering the store, gather all necessary supplies, such as writing utensils, notepads, and printed survey questions provided by your supervisor.

💼 Arrive at the back stock area, sign in, and grab a cart or u-boat.

🔍 Locate the designated area for backstock, potentially requiring a ladder.

📸 Take before and after images at various locations to showcase the impact of merchandising.

🗑️ Ensure all trash is cleaned up both on the sales floor and in the back room.

Time management is crucial for retail merchandisers, as they must complete initiatives within a 45-minute time limit.

📝 After finishing tasks, retail merchandisers record the time they sign out with the receiver to track their progress.

🛍️ While some stores can be completed in less than 45 minutes, large stores often require the full time limit.
